Tri-City Raceway Park Canceled Sunday, July 17

(Franklin, PA July 17, 2022):  With severe thunderstorms forecasted to hit Tri-City Raceway Park right around race time, track owner Merle Black made the difficult decision to cancel the racing action scheduled for Sunday, July 17.

“The safety of our fans, competitors, and staff is very important to us,” Black said. “We could not take the chance of bringing everybody to the facility and then have the storms come rolling in.”

The next two Sundays, July 24 and 31, will, ironically, be Sunday Thunder events, with racing for the four classes:  the Shawgo Real Estate, LLC 410 Sprint Cars, the Donovan & Bauer Auto Group 358 Modifieds, the Hovis Auto & Truck Supply Pro Stocks, and the 4 Your Car Connection Mini Stocks.  

Racing will start at 6 p.m. Pit gates will open at 2 p.m., and spectator gates will open at 4 p.m.

Coming up on Sunday, August 21, the World of Outlaws Late Model Series will invade Tri-City Raceway Park and the 4 Your Car Connection Mini Stocks will also be in action. Please note that putting the Mini Stocks on the card is a schedule change due to a conflicting date for the RUSH Sprint Cars.
